The map is several orders bigger - it covers the whole galaxy.

The AI has been totally revamped to make it much harder.

The Strike cruiser category has been removed completely. They were utterly useless, aside from defending a starbase. The ships remain but they've been given decent armoury and weapons so they can actually participate.
 
McAvoy - I think the largest system you can play is in the region of 15 000 systems, so just a tad bigger! :D

shameless - I think they're adopting the Explorer, scout type referencing. The Nebula, for instance would be an Explorer, while the Romulan Strike ship will be a cruiser or similar. It was suggested that they just have the class name rather than a descriptive title, but I'm not sure that's been adopted.
 
The minor races can expand too, so you could theoretically come up against a Bajoran empire, or a Vulcan one. Or the Borg collective... :evil:

They're all in it as minor races, including the Ferengi. You're talking around 50 minor races, at least.

The game is designed to be moddable, so someone will undoubtedly create an option for you to play the minors as major races.
 
110 minor races to date, some will have severel types of ship, such as the vulcans brenn and andorians o and also the xindi.

Oh, just one question, will espionage and sabotage actually... you know, WORK? ;) - In the original BotF I was always being sabotaged, but I could never do it myself...
 
^Yes, and there are many more options to actually direct your sabotage.

There are also a number of races that boost your spy skills, including internal security, so you won't have to scramble for the Betazoids quite so much.
